Triazole Fungicides Market Overview

The Global Triazole Fungicides Market is estimated to reach at a high CAGR during the forecast period (2023-2030).

Triazoles are the most common range of fungicides used for the control of plant diseases. Triazoles are absorbed and translocated in the plants where they function both as preventive and curative medicine by destroying the germ tubes. These control a wide variety of fungi and are active at low rates. They also affect plant development and growth and can protect them against environmental stress. Above all, triazoles have shown positive results towards the protection of crops from various fungi and hence the market growth can be anticipated in the future along with demand for crop protection.

Triazole Fungicides Market Dynamics

The growing need for crop protection is driving the global triazole fungicides market

Growing demand for agricultural production coupled with increasing population and their changing dietary preferences towards fresh farm produce led to the growth of the triazole fungicides market. Since fungal diseases are a major threat to the growth of crops, the use of fungicides to combat fungal infections, thereby improving farm yield. Triazole fungicides have shown effective results towards controlling plant diseases, especially controlling the blackleg disease in canola. The blackleg disease is the primary disease of canola worldwide which causes annual losses of 10–15% with localized epidemics resulting in up to 90% yield loss in Australia, which is why the use of Triazole fungicides have increased rigorously in Australia since 2005. High moisture and moderate temperatures favor the growth of fungi and countries with such climatic conditions as Peru and Brazil are proving growth opportunities for the triazole fungicides market.

Environmental concerns associated with chemical residues are the major restraint to the global triazole fungicides market. Triazole fungicides are usually sprayed directly on plants and reach the roots and contaminate the soil. It has been classified in the United States Environmental Protection Agency Office of Pesticide Programs carcinogenic list as a potential carcinogen (possible carcinogen). Its acute toxicity is moderate and classified as III (mildly dangerous) according to the World Health Organization toxicity classification.

Triazole Fungicides Market Segmentation Analysis

Tebuconazole is a versatile fungicide, and hence dominated the triazole fungicides market by type

Tebuconazole is highly popular among all triazole fungicides. It is used to treat various fungal diseases such as rust fungus, sheath blight, leaf spot, and anthracnose. According to studies, Tebuconazole is considered a versatile fungicide as it can be used for the treatment of both curative and preventive fungi. Grapes, cereals, cherries, almonds, canola and rapeseed are the major crop categories using tebuconazole. The production of this fungicide is largely consolidated in China, with production share reaching nearly 70% in 2019.

Based on crop type, the cereals and grains segment held a market revenue share of YY% in the year 2020. The cereals & grains segment in the market comprises different crops, such as rice, wheat, and corn. According to the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ations, the production of cereal crops will increase by 60% from 2000 to 2050. The production of cereals and grains vary across different regions, depending on the topography and climatic conditions. Due to this, the cereals & grains segment recorded the highest consumption of fungicides in the North American and Asia Pacific regions. According to the FAO, global cereal production in 2016 recorded nearly 2,543 million tons, which is around 0.6% higher than the previous year. Rice is the most widely consumed staple food, particularly in Asia. It is the second-most widely produced grain after corn.      

Global Triazole Fungicides Market Geographical Share

China led Asia-Pacific to the top of the triazole fungicides market, owing to increasing agricultural activities

Asia Pacific evolved as the largest market for triazole fungicides, accounting for a share of YY% in the global sales revenue. China and India are the major contributors in terms of sales volume owing to the large agricultural activities and consumption of a broad range of crops including field crops, vegetables and turf. The growing farming activities and increasing rate of fungicide application are propelling the market growth in the region. The rising population and need for farm produce are contributing to the growth of atriazole fungicides market in this region. According to University of Melbourne and Zhejiang researcher Baojing Gu, China remains the world’s largest consumer of agrochemicals with consumption exceeding 30% of global fertilizers and pesticides consumption. The large production of cereal crops, like rice and wheat in India, is the major factor supporting market growth. Wheat production is estimated to increase to a record 108.75 million tonnes in 2020-21 from 107.86 million tonnes in the previous year, while the output of coarse cereals is likely to increase to 49.66 million tonnes, from 47.75 million tonnes a year ago. Triazole and benzimidazole fungicides have been used for controlling Fusarium head blight (FHB) in wheat for over two decades.

Triazole Fungicides Market Companies and Competitive Landscape

The global triazole fungicides market is highly competitive with some of the pioneer and new emerging players in the market. Key players like BASF, Chemtura Corporation, Corteva, Inc., Cheminova, Bayer Cropscience and Nufarm Limited adopted the strategy of acquisitions, mergers, partnerships and product launches to gain significant market share. For instance, in April 2021, Syngenta has added two novel fungicides: Mitrion (benzovindiflupyr + prothioconazole) and Alade (benzovindiflupyr + cyproconazole + difenoconazole), keeping in mind diseases such as Cercosporiosis, target spot disease, anthracnose and Asian rust that have increasingly affected soybean productivity in recent years and can cause losses of up to 90% of the crop, generating billions in annual losses. Alade brings the double systemic action of Cyproconazole and Difenoconazole, two highly selective and effective triazoles. In 2019, BASF launched its new triazole fungicide active ingredient under the brand Revysol. Revysol is used in novel triazole fungicides - Veltyma for corn and Revytek for soybeans

COVID-19 Impact

The global market remained nearly resilient to the pandemic in terms of volume sales

As the agricultural practices were exempted from all the restrictions, the demand for triazole fungicides was not impacted. But during the first half of the pandemic, the sales of certain agrochemicals slightly declined due to disruptions in trading activities, while the sales of pesticides weren’t much impacted. ​In terms of supply, a short-term shortage of migrant laborers amid distribution bottlenecks created a wide gap between the number of workers required for the production of agrochemicals and the ones available. The production of crops also decreased due to the unavailability of laborers in large-scale plantations. Many triazole fungicides manufacturers were facing issues due to lack of raw material availability, which has led to the reduction of various agrochemical product manufacturing. Post COVID-19, the agricultural activities have normalized, which has helped the companies to deliver products to target locations.
